This poem is taken from PN Review 167, Volume 32 Number 3, January - February 2006.

Being a Human Being

Tom Leonard

for Mordechai Vanunu

not to be complicit
not to accept everyone else is silent it must be all right

not to keep one's mouth shut to hold onto one's job
not to accept public language as cover and decoy

not to put friends and family before the rest of the world
not to say I am wrong when you know the government is wrong

not to be just a bought behaviour pattern
